Jackie Madden

Director, Engineering at Dispatch

Jackie Madden is currently the Director of Engineering at Dispatch. Jackie has over 17 years of experience in the software engineering field. Prior to Dispatch, Jackie worked as a Senior Software Engineer at Tyler Technologies for over 16 years. There, they were responsible for analyzing, designing, programming, testing, documenting and supporting small to large modifications to the Munis application suite. Jackie also worked directly with sites to perform custom database modifications in conjunction with application modifications. Additionally, Jackie created SSRS custom reports, from simple design and data sets to complex drill-down detail. Furthermore, Jackie developed the Chart of Accounts Redesign module for sites to replace the Munis account structure.

Prior to their work at Tyler Technologies, Jackie worked as a Quality Assurance Engineer at Dynamix for just under 2 years. There they designed and implemented an automated system to improve quality and resource effectiveness. Jackie also introduced focus groups to enhance game design and improve end user expectations while at Dynamix.

Jackie began their career in 1995 as the Projects and Systems Coordinator in HR at Community Health and Counseling Services where they worked for 3 years.

Jackie Madden has a Bachelor of Science in Computer and Information Sciences from the University of Oregon, as well as a Bachelor of Arts in Mathematics from the University of Maine.
